Introduction
Le développement web est un domaine en pleine expansion, attirant de plus en plus de passionnés désireux de créer des sites et applications. Face à cette popularité, beaucoup se demandent : peut-on réellement apprendre le développement web seul, sans suivre de formation formelle ? Dans cet article, nous explorons cette question et vous donnons les clés pour réussir votre apprentissage en autonomie.
Pourquoi apprendre le développement web en autodidacte ?
Apprendre seul présente plusieurs avantages :
- Flexibilité : Vous avancez à votre rythme, selon votre emploi du temps.
- Économie : Beaucoup de ressources gratuites ou peu coûteuses sont disponibles en ligne.
- Personnalisation : Vous choisissez les technologies et projets qui vous intéressent vraiment.
Les défis de l’apprentissage en solo
Cependant, l’autodidaxie comporte aussi des difficultés :
- Manque de structure : Sans programme défini, il est facile de se perdre ou de manquer des bases importantes.
- Motivation : Apprendre seul demande une grande discipline.
- Absence de retours immédiats : Il peut être compliqué de corriger ses erreurs sans mentor ou communauté.
Les étapes clés pour apprendre le développement web seul
1. Définir vos objectifs
Avant de commencer, clarifiez ce que vous souhaitez accomplir : créer un site personnel, devenir développeur professionnel, ou lancer une startup ? Cette étape vous aidera à choisir les bonnes technologies et ressources.
2. Choisir un langage et un framework adaptés
Pour les débutants, il est conseillé de commencer par :
- HTML et CSS : pour la structure et le design des pages web.
- JavaScript : pour rendre les sites interactifs.
Ensuite, vous pouvez explorer des frameworks populaires comme React, Vue.js ou Angular selon vos objectifs.
3. Utiliser des ressources en ligne de qualité
Voici quelques types de ressources recommandées :
- Tutoriels vidéo (YouTube, plateformes comme Udemy ou OpenClassrooms).
- Documentation officielle des langages et frameworks.
- Forums et communautés (Stack Overflow, Reddit).
- Projets pratiques et challenges de code (FreeCodeCamp, Codewars).
4. Pratiquer régulièrement
La pratique est essentielle. Il est conseillé de :
- Réaliser des petits projets concrets pour appliquer les notions apprises.
- Contribuer à des projets open source pour acquérir de l’expérience réelle.
- Participer à des hackathons ou challenges en ligne.
5. Rejoindre une communauté
Intégrer un groupe de développeurs peut grandement faciliter votre progression grâce aux échanges, partages et retours constructifs.
Conclusion
Apprendre le développement web seul est tout à fait possible, à condition d’être motivé, organisé et de disposer des bonnes ressources. Avec de la discipline et une pratique régulière, vous pourrez acquérir les compétences nécessaires pour créer vos propres projets et peut-être même entamer une carrière dans ce domaine passionnant.
Prêt à vous lancer ? Commencez dès aujourd’hui en choisissant un premier tutoriel et créez votre premier site web !